There is probably some subtle socket default difference between it and Ubuntu; "bug#21993: REPL Servers broken on OSX" states the problem does not exist on that distro. In the file: module/system/repl/server.scm at line 127: ;; Put the socket into non-blocking mode. (fcntl server-socket F_SETFL (logior O_NONBLOCK (fcntl server-socket F_GETFL))) and I then refer you to this page: http://stackoverflow.com/questions/14370489/what-can-cause-a-resource-temporarily-unavailable-on-sock-send-command of which the essence is, from the send() man page: That's because you're using a non-blocking socket and the output buffer is full. When the message does not fit into the send buffer of the socket, send() normally blocks, unless the socket has been placed in non-block- ing I/O mode. In non-blocking mode it would return EAGAIN in this case. The blowout seems to happen immediately the socket connects, that makes me think that the send buffer should be initially empty to the new client connection so I can only imagine that either something filled it really quick or there is some kind of edge case with socket options being managed slightly differently across platform stacks.
